#16c654 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16c654 is composed of 8.6% red, 77.6%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 141.1 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 43.1%. #16c654 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ffa8 with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#16c654 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16c654 has RGB values of R:22, G:198,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1492564.

Shades and Tints of #16c654
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000402 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f5 is the lightest one.
